Former Mitsubishi Executive Yoshihisa Hara Joins Japan Aerospace & Defense Consulting as Advisor

Former Mitsubishi Electric Executive Joins JADC



In a significant move for the defense consulting landscape, Yoshihisa Hara, a former executive vice president at Mitsubishi Electric Corporation, has been appointed as an advisor to Japan Aerospace & Defense Consulting (JADC), effective April 1, 2026. Additionally, he will also serve as an industry advisor for SHIFT, a company dedicated to supporting the development of software services and products. This strategic appointment marks a new chapter for JADC, a specialized consulting firm focused on defense sectors under the SHIFT group.

Yoshihisa Hara's Background



Yoshihisa Hara has a long-standing career at Mitsubishi Electric, where he joined the company in 1983. Over the years, he concentrated on the defense and aerospace segments, playing a pivotal role in various radar development projects including synthetic aperture radars for aircraft and satellites. By 2016, he was the head of the Kamakura factory, and in 2018, he took charge of the communication equipment factory. Most recently, from 2019 to 2023, he was responsible for overseeing Mitsubishi Electric’s Defense and Space Systems division. Hara also served as the vice chairman of the Japan Aerospace Industry Association from 2020 to 2021.

JADC's Mission and Recent Developments



The establishment of JADC stemmed from SHIFT’s foray into defense consulting, beginning in 2022 with their first defense-related project. The firm has been actively engaged in supporting defense-related ministries and enterprises, increasingly prioritizing the hiring of specialists in this field. In October 2023, esteemed industry expert Hidemitsu Watanabe was appointed as industry advisor, amplifying the firm’s industry knowledge and guidance. This has enabled JADC to launch services such as RMF consulting and cybersecurity framework developments tailored for defense industries.

JADC aims to cultivate a bridge between public and private sectors, emphasizing collaboration, research, and training programs aligned with national security needs. For instance, they are progressing in expanding the RMF education program to meet the operational needs of defense procurement practitioners.

A Promising Future for JADC



JADC, founded in April 2025 under the SHIFT group, boasts a roster of seasoned professionals with expertise in international security dynamics and the domestic defense industry. They provide a variety of services, including research, technical support, and RMF consulting, aimed at helping numerous stakeholders in the defense sector resolve challenges and enhance public-private collaboration.

As part of their efforts, JADC regularly publishes reports on current security conditions and trends in the defense market, providing critical insights to their members and stakeholders.
